Display format

The Model 2520 display is used primarily to display measured readings and source values.
The top line displays source values, and the bottom line shows measured values.

Display example

The following example shows the unit displaying the laser diode source value on the top
line, and the laser diode voltage, detector 1 current, and detector 2 current from left to
right on the bottom line:
Ipulse:100.00mA
+1.0000 V +05.000mA +10.000mA

Display units

Measurement reading information can be displayed using either engineering units or
scientific notation in either fixed- or floating-point format. Use the NUMBERS selection
of the main MENU to select the display format.
Engineering units example: 12.345mA
Scientific notation example: 1.23e -2A
